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7646924 11780158897 668461 656530
2242840434 38922816 2865
2242840434 38922816 2865
610 2578 3228292 23061 06065050770
All about undefined
Interested in learning more?
2242840434 38922816 2865
610 2578 3228292 23061 06065050770
See more
563 694
7461710 87 05
See more
439433047 1097830361 76787
026583 1009500572 61
See more